We are looking for a Senior Technology Auditor to lead SOX compliance efforts for Netflix. This position is based in Los Gatos, California.

Responsibilities:

  • Lead all phases of the IT SOX program in a complex and evolving environment. This includes performing walkthroughs, testing, detailed reviews (ITGCs, Application controls, IPE testing, SOC review, etc), and communicating results to stakeholders.

  • Effectively audit home-grown systems, with experiences in providing control assurance through code review.  In most cases, this will include designing and executing procedures to audit 1st-party systems.

  • Partner with relevant engineering process owners and teams to stay up-to-date on changes and provide guidance on controls by performing SOX readiness procedures across a variety of 1st-party systems.

  • Communicate effectively and efficiently with stakeholders to build trust and credibility. 

  • Identify improvements and automation opportunities to increase efficiency and impact of audit procedures. 

  • Collaborate with external auditors on an ongoing basis to ensure continued alignment and timely completion of agreed-upon milestones.

  • Leverage data analytics, GenAI, and automation in all phases of audit and advisory reviews.

  • Support internal initiatives (tools, training, methodology, and automation) to build and improve the Technology audit function

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s or Master’s (is a plus) degree in Information Systems, Computer Science or related field. 

  • 6+ years of experience in technology audit. A combination of consulting (Big 4 or related) and industry internal audit experience is preferred.

  • Exceptional project management skills. Ability to work with a high-performing team, managing a variety of deliverables simultaneously to successful completion.

  • Excellent communication skills (written and verbal), sound judgment in analyzing problems, with proficiency in assessing risk and evaluating internal controls. 

  • Proactive, self-starter, attention to detail, proven ability to meet deadlines while producing high-quality work products.

  • Open to receiving and providing constructive feedback, and focused on continuous improvement by incorporating feedback into measurable actions.

  • Strong grasp of basic technology concepts (infrastructure, applications, etc) and experience auditing 1-party systems is required.

  • Proficient in using computer software (e.g., SQL, Tableau and cloud ERP systems (e.g. Workday).

  • Familiarity with using audit systems (e.g., Auditboard) to manage end-to-end SOX programs

  • Strong critical thinking mentality, strong analytical and problem-solving 

  • Able to work closely with people at all levels of the organization and facilitate discussions with management regarding audit findings and implementation of corrective actions

  • Understanding of commonly used internal control frameworks including COBIT, NIST Cybersecurity Framework, etc

  • CISA, CIA, and Big 4 consulting experience is a plus
